Centre announces new railway zone with Visakhapatnam as the headquarters

And the announcement has finally been made! Bringing an end to a long wait and confirming the numerous speculations, Union Railways Minister Piyush Goyal, on Wednesday evening, announced that a new railway zone, headquartered in Visakhapatnam, will be established in Andhra Pradesh. The new zone will be christened as South Coast Railway.

“The matter has been examined in detail in consultation with stakeholders, and it has been decided to go ahead with the creation of a new zone, with headquarters at Visakhapatnam. The new zone shall be named South Coast Railway, short form SCoR. It will comprise of the existing Guntakal, Guntur, and Vijayawada Division,” Piyush Goyal said.

The Railways Minister further informed that the present Waltair division will be divided into two parts. One part will be incorporated in the new SCoR, and will be merged with the neighbouring Vijayawada division. The remaining portion, on the other hand, shall be converted into a New Division with headquarters at Rayagada under East Coast Railway in Odisha.

Addressing a press conference, Goyal said that the South Central Railway will comprise of Hyderabad, Secunderabad, Nanded divisions as at present. He also added that works towards establishing the new railway zone with Visakhapatnam as its headquarters will begin soon.

It may be recalled that BJP’s top brass from Visakhapatnam had met Piyush Goyal recently and urged him to announce the railway zone in Andhra Pradesh at the earliest. The leaders had stated that the issue of the zone had now turned into sentiment for the people of the state.

It may be noted that the announcement comes just before Prime Minister Narendra Modi’s visit to Visakhapatnam. The PM is slated to visit the city on 1 March and address a massive public meeting.
